#f3dd53 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f3dd53 is composed of 95.3% red, 86.7%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.1% magenta, 65.8%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 51.8 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 63.9%. #f3dd53 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#e7bb00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#f3dd53

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0a01 is the darkest color, while #fffef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f3dd53

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a5a1 is the less saturated color, while #fae24c is the most saturated one.
